About The Position

The Wholesale National Account Manager is responsible for driving sales performance, brand elevation, and strategic growth across a defined territory. This role partners closely with wholesale accounts to ensure exceptional brand representation, commercial excellence, and sustainable revenue growth aligned with the brand’s prestige positioning.

Responsibilities

  • Deliver and exceed regional sales targets across wholesale specialty partners (Jewelers and Traditional Trade)
  • Analyze sell-in and sell-through performance to identify growth opportunities and corrective actions.
  • Develop and execute territory action plans to maximize productivity, assortment optimization, and distribution strategy.
  • Lead twice a year seasonal sell-in campaigns, product launches, and novelties presentations.
  • Cultivate strong relationships with partners’ sales associates, key retail partners and decision-makers.
  • Elevate brand presence through merchandising excellence, visual standards, and client experience execution.
  • Conduct regular business reviews, providing data-driven insights and clear growth strategies.
  • Identify white-space opportunities and strategic doors aligned with brand positioning.
  • Host product knowledge and storytelling trainings to empower sales associates.
  • Drive brand engagement initiatives to maximize conversion and average selling price.
  • Ensure accurate forecasting, inventory management, and stock optimization across accounts.
  • Monitor order management, replenishment flow, and operational compliance.
  • Maintain CRM discipline and timely reporting to headquarters.
  • Partner with Marketing team to maximize brand exposure, identifying opportunities for clienteling events and community engagement that elevate brand visibility.
